Overview

LA Canita Beach, a 196-seat permanent food service establishment in Miami Beach, has averaged 5 violations per inspection across 17 inspections on record since 2016, in line with the Florida statewide average. The facility has not experienced emergency closure but has received a warning and multiple complaint-based inspections. Recent inspections show recurring violations in food contact surfaces and time-temperature control: food contact surfaces were cited in 5 of the last 6 inspections, and time as a control was flagged in 2 of the last 3 inspections. Shell stock requirements, approved food sources, and allergen awareness violations also appeared in recent records. A fire safety violation involving a portable fire extinguisher in the red zone was documented on January 25, 2021. The most recent inspection on March 5, 2026 resulted in a "Call Back - Complied" disposition following citation of three food contact surface violations on February 25, 2026.
